Reviews

All About Opposites is a new series that offers very basic information, often using only the two words from the title of the book. The image on the book's cover of the front and the back of a rabbit establishes the format for this book. It follows the same pattern as Day and Night, except in this title most of the pairings are animals. The closing pages feature a young girl who looks like a fairy princess. Again the animals are not identified, but they should be familiar to most adults who would be using this title with a child. For example, there is a cat, rabbit and dog. The closing pages do offer some amusement with a rabbit in a hat, which unfortunately may go right over the heads of young readers. The book closes with references that are reasonably current, links to two websites and an index. The book is identified as Guided Reading level A with the word count of ten., Children's Literature
